Governance Institutions and the Capacity to Adapt to Climate Change in Two Rural Communities in Alberta
DownloadFall 2010
Adaptation is now recognized as an important aspect of responses to climate change. Rural communities in the prairie provinces of Canada are considered to be sensitive to the impacts of climate change due to socio-economic and geographical factors.
